Branch: refs/heads/main
  Home:   https://github.com/WebKit/WebKit
  Commit: 178858db52533be28686fc5e90aa465d9cb78656
      
https://github.com/WebKit/WebKit/commit/178858db52533be28686fc5e90aa465d9cb78656
  Author: Rupin Mittal <[email protected]>
  Date:   2025-07-10 (Thu, 10 Jul 2025)

  Changed paths:
    M Source/WebCore/Modules/cookie-store/CookieStore.cpp
    M Source/WebCore/Modules/webaudio/AudioWorkletThread.cpp
    M Source/WebCore/Modules/webaudio/AudioWorkletThread.h
    M Source/WebCore/SaferCPPExpectations/NoUnretainedMemberCheckerExpectations
    M Source/WebCore/SaferCPPExpectations/UncheckedCallArgsCheckerExpectations
    M Source/WebCore/SaferCPPExpectations/UnretainedCallArgsCheckerExpectations
    M Source/WebCore/platform/Cookie.h
    M Source/WebCore/platform/network/cocoa/CookieCocoa.mm
    M Source/WebCore/platform/network/cocoa/CookieStorageObserver.mm
    M Source/WebCore/workers/WorkerOrWorkletThread.cpp
    M Source/WebCore/workers/WorkerOrWorkletThread.h
    M Source/WebCore/workers/WorkerThread.h
    M Source/WebKit/SaferCPPExpectations/UncheckedCallArgsCheckerExpectations
    M Source/WebKit/SaferCPPExpectations/UncountedCallArgsCheckerExpectations
    M Source/WebKit/SaferCPPExpectations/UnretainedCallArgsCheckerExpectations
    M Source/WebKit/Shared/cf/CookieStorageUtilsCF.mm
    M Source/WebKit/UIProcess/API/Cocoa/WKHTTPCookieStore.mm
    M Source/WebKit/WebProcess/WebPage/Cocoa/WebCookieJarCocoa.mm
    M Source/WebKit/WebProcess/WebPage/WebCookieCache.cpp
    M Source/WebKit/WebProcess/WebPage/WebCookieCache.h
    M Source/WebKit/WebProcess/WebPage/WebCookieJar.h

  Log Message:
  -----------
  Fix more static analyzer warnings in cookie code
https://bugs.webkit.org/show_bug.cgi?id=295675
rdar://155477189

Reviewed by Chris Dumez.

* Source/WebCore/Modules/cookie-store/CookieStore.cpp:
(WebCore::CookieStore::MainThreadBridge::ensureOnMainThread):
* Source/WebCore/Modules/webaudio/AudioWorkletThread.cpp:
(WebCore::AudioWorkletThread::workerLoaderProxy const):
(WebCore::AudioWorkletThread::workerLoaderProxy): Deleted.
* Source/WebCore/Modules/webaudio/AudioWorkletThread.h:
* Source/WebCore/SaferCPPExpectations/NoUnretainedMemberCheckerExpectations:
* Source/WebCore/SaferCPPExpectations/UncheckedCallArgsCheckerExpectations:
* Source/WebCore/SaferCPPExpectations/UnretainedCallArgsCheckerExpectations:
* Source/WebCore/platform/Cookie.h:
* Source/WebCore/platform/network/cocoa/CookieCocoa.mm:
(WebCore::Cookie::operator NSHTTPCookie * _Nullable  const):
(WebCore::Cookie::operator== const):
(WebCore::Cookie::hash const):
(WebCore::Cookie::toProtectedNSHTTPCookie const):
* Source/WebCore/platform/network/cocoa/CookieStorageObserver.mm:
* Source/WebCore/workers/WorkerOrWorkletThread.cpp:
(WebCore::WorkerOrWorkletThread::checkedWorkerLoaderProxy const):
* Source/WebCore/workers/WorkerOrWorkletThread.h:
* Source/WebCore/workers/WorkerThread.h:
* Source/WebKit/SaferCPPExpectations/UncheckedCallArgsCheckerExpectations:
* Source/WebKit/SaferCPPExpectations/UncountedCallArgsCheckerExpectations:
* Source/WebKit/SaferCPPExpectations/UnretainedCallArgsCheckerExpectations:
* Source/WebKit/Shared/cf/CookieStorageUtilsCF.mm:
(WebKit::cookieStorageFromIdentifyingData):
* Source/WebKit/UIProcess/API/Cocoa/WKHTTPCookieStore.mm:
(WKHTTPCookieStoreObserver::create):
(-[WKHTTPCookieStore _protectedCookieStore]):
(-[WKHTTPCookieStore dealloc]):
(-[WKHTTPCookieStore getAllCookies:]):
(-[WKHTTPCookieStore setCookie:completionHandler:]):
(-[WKHTTPCookieStore setCookies:completionHandler:]):
(-[WKHTTPCookieStore deleteCookie:completionHandler:]):
(-[WKHTTPCookieStore addObserver:]):
(-[WKHTTPCookieStore removeObserver:]):
(-[WKHTTPCookieStore setCookiePolicy:completionHandler:]):
(-[WKHTTPCookieStore getCookiePolicy:]):
(-[WKHTTPCookieStore _getCookiesForURL:completionHandler:]):
(-[WKHTTPCookieStore _setCookieAcceptPolicy:completionHandler:]):
(-[WKHTTPCookieStore _flushCookiesToDiskWithCompletionHandler:]):
(-[WKHTTPCookieStore _setCookies:completionHandler:]):
* Source/WebKit/WebProcess/WebPage/Cocoa/WebCookieJarCocoa.mm:
(WebKit::WebCookieJar::cookiesInPartitionedCookieStorage const):
(WebKit::WebCookieJar::setCookiesInPartitionedCookieStorage):
(WebKit::WebCookieJar::ensurePartitionedCookieStorage):
* Source/WebKit/WebProcess/WebPage/WebCookieCache.cpp:
(WebKit::WebCookieCache::cookiesForDOM):
(WebKit::WebCookieCache::setCookiesFromDOM):
(WebKit::WebCookieCache::didSetCookieFromDOM):
(WebKit::WebCookieCache::cookiesAdded):
(WebKit::WebCookieCache::cookiesDeleted):
(WebKit::WebCookieCache::clearForHost):
* Source/WebKit/WebProcess/WebPage/WebCookieCache.h:
* Source/WebKit/WebProcess/WebPage/WebCookieJar.h:

Canonical link: https://commits.webkit.org/297232@main



To unsubscribe from these emails, change your notification settings at 
https://github.com/WebKit/WebKit/settings/notifications
_______________________________________________
webkit-changes mailing list
[email protected]
https://lists.webkit.org/mailman/listinfo/webkit-changes

Reply via email to